A Unique Opportunity

Becoming a stay-at-home parent is a decision that carries profound implications and blessings. It offers a unique opportunity to witness your child’s growth firsthand, creating lasting memories and forging an unbreakable bond. The privilege of being present for those precious milestones, from first words to first steps, is a gift that cannot be quantified.

Potential Challenges

But while the rewards of being a stay-at-home parent are abundant, it is essential to consider the challenges too. Financial considerations, potential feelings of isolation, and the need for a strong support network are factors that require careful thought and planning. However, these challenges can be navigated.

The Final Decision

Ultimately, the decision to be a stay-at-home parent is deeply personal. It involves weighing your family’s values, dynamics, and individual aspirations. Reflect on your priorities, discuss openly with your partner, and trust your intuition. There’s no wrong decision here!
